The Nightfill scheduler runs nightly backfills for the Cardamom analytics warehouse, kicking off at 02:15 local to the Veldt cluster. It authenticates as svc-nightfill and claims partitions via the ledger table, so concurrent runs are safe but wasteful. Maintainers should note that retries are capped at three per partition; after that, the partition is parked for manual review. The scheduler reaches the warehouse ingest API through the Bramblegate proxy, which requires its own credential. The current key is below.

gateway credential: kto23_LX9A4ys6i4nzHtpOLNLodKK

The default payroll export format has changed from the legacy fixed-width layout to the signed CSV profile. This affects all tenants that never explicitly set an export format; previously they silently inherited fixed-width output with no integrity checksum. The new default embeds a per-file digest and rejects exports containing unmasked account fields. Legacy output remains available behind an explicit opt-in flag, logged on every use for audit purposes. The relevant defaults now shipped with the service are as follows.

settings of kafof-kaduf:
QUENAX_LOG_LEVEL=info
QUENAX_METRICS_HOST=metrics.quenax.tolvaqcorp.corp
QUENAX_POOL_SIZE=4

For newcomers: the Tindermere events table is partitioned by month so queries prune old data and vacuum stays cheap. When reviewing, always confirm new queries include the partition key, or they scan everything. Retention and partition sizing are governed by a few constants, which I've summarized below for reference.

constants for fajop-tahaf:
RATE_LIMITS = {
    "holael": 2,
    "oliael": 10,
    "druael": 10,
    "wenwyn": 10,
}

Q4 Planning Note — Headcount

Welcome aboard! Quick summary for next year: we're asking for twelve new roles across the Marwell division, mostly engineers for the Skylark build, plus two ops hires in the Denbrook branch. Freya has the detailed breakdown ready whenever you want it. The confidential planning note follows directly below.

management briefing: Project Ulavan slips by two quarters because of the staffing delay.